Transaction dfc98633efe40531369f1177852b03225020bf0b42ff914518d99b732e6325d9
1 Input
1 Output
-
dfc98633efe40531369f1177852b03225020bf0b42ff914518d99b732e6325d9:0
- value
- 132900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a5365a4120ac82ab77dcf749257cb40e0fb2961 OP_EQUAL
- address
- 3Fm1tcX48FM4kEGF8pqFmt3dFQZxP27eMe